Output 59dd8e80f29570a185900542c73f862e07c59bb4775947825383c0b4e60c8af8:0

value
17019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f819f92cd5847bacb38eb26b08516772016a99 OP_EQUAL
address
3CSnCNxijXjZ3ZcqgoG4Pzu2LZqLqobT4F
transaction
59dd8e80f29570a185900542c73f862e07c59bb4775947825383c0b4e60c8af8
spent
true